Where are AutoCAD files stored? Autosave files, by default, get saved in the Windows %temp% location (on the local PC). But you can redirect them to any other location, inside of OPTIONS, on the FILES tab. Note that they are deleted by design when you exit AutoCAD normally.

How do I recover AutoCAD files?

To recover an autosave file:

  1. Open the Autosave folder. On Windows: by default it’s the Temp folder. You may open it by typing %tmp% into the Start menu. …
  2. Look for a file with the same name of the one to recover, a time stamp code, and an SV$ extension.
  3. Change the SV$ extension to DWG.
  4. Open the file in AutoCAD.

Can you use Fusion 360 offline?

Fusion 360 can work offline for a couple of weeks at a time, but must connect to the Internet to validate the license, push updates, and sync data every two weeks.

Which layer Cannot be deleted in AutoCAD?

The following layers cannot be deleted: Layer 0 and Defpoints. The current layer. Layers containing objects.
